编程猫引擎指令是什么
-
编程猫引擎指令是一套用于控制编程猫机器人的命令集合。通过使用这些指令,用户可以编写程序,通过编程猫机器人完成各种动作和任务。下面是编程猫引擎指令的一些常见用法及其说明:
-
前进/后退指令:用于控制机器人向前或向后移动一定距离。例如,前进10厘米,后退5厘米。
-
左转/右转指令:用于控制机器人向左或向右转动一定角度。例如,左转90度,右转45度。
-
停止指令:用于停止机器人的移动动作。例如,停止移动。
-
前进/后退一段时间指令:用于控制机器人向前或向后持续移动一段时间。例如,前进2秒,后退3秒。
-
左转/右转一段时间指令:用于控制机器人向左或向右持续转动一段时间。例如,左转1秒,右转0.5秒。
-
重复指令:用于重复执行某一段指令。例如,重复10次前进5厘米。
-
条件指令:用于根据条件进行判断和执行相应的动作。例如,如果前方有障碍物,则停止移动。
-
声音指令:用于播放声音或音乐。例如,播放音乐,播放声音。
-
灯光指令:用于控制机器人的灯光效果。例如,打开前灯,关闭后灯。
-
传感器指令:用于读取机器人的各种传感器数据。例如,读取温度传感器数值,读取光线传感器数值。
以上仅为编程猫引擎指令的一部分,它们可以组合使用,通过编写程序来完成各种机器人的控制任务。使用这些指令,用户可以探索机器人编程的乐趣,并实现自己的创意想法。
1年前 -
-
编程猫引擎(Coding Cat Engine)是一款教育编程平台,用于教授儿童和初学者学习编程。编程猫引擎使用一种简单的指令系统来控制角色的移动和交互。下面是一些编程猫引擎常用的指令:
-
前进/后退:使用指令"move forward"或"move backward"来使角色向前或向后移动一定的步数。
-
左转/右转:使用指令"turn left"或"turn right"来使角色在原地左转或右转一定的角度。
-
条件判断:使用指令"if/else"来进行条件判断,根据判断结果执行不同的操作。例如,可以使用"if touching wall"来判断是否与墙壁接触,然后执行相应的动作。
-
循环:使用指令"repeat"或"while"来实现循环操作,重复执行一系列指令直到满足条件。例如,可以使用"repeat 5 times"来重复执行下面的指令5次。
-
事件触发:使用指令"when"来定义事件触发的条件,当满足条件时执行相应的操作。例如,可以使用"when click"来定义当鼠标点击时执行某个动作。
需要注意的是,编程猫引擎的指令系统可以根据不同的版本和场景进行扩展和定制。上述指令只是其中的一部分常见指令,具体的指令还可以根据编程猫引擎的具体需求进行定制。在编程猫引擎中,通过组合和使用这些指令,可以编写出各种有趣的程序和游戏,帮助学习者掌握编程的基本概念和技巧。
1年前 -
-
编程猫引擎(MakeCode)是一个图形化编程工具,它使用积木块而不是传统的代码,使初学者能够更容易地理解和编写程序。编程猫引擎有许多指令可以用于创建各种程序。下面是一些常见的编程猫引擎指令:
-
控制流指令:
- 当条件为真时循环(while loop):重复执行一组指令,直到满足条件的预设成立。
- 重复循环(repeat loop):指定一个次数,重复执行一组指令。
- 如果条件为真则执行(if statement):根据条件执行一组指令。
- 如果条件为真则执行,否则执行(if-else statement):根据条件执行不同的指令。
- 中断程序 (break):中断当前的循环或程序。
-
运算指令:
- 赋值(set variable):将一个数值或表达式赋给一个变量。
- 加法(addition):将两个数值相加。
- 减法(subtraction):将两个数值相减。
- 乘法(multiplication):将两个数值相乘。
- 除法(division):将两个数值相除。
- 取余(modulus):取两个数相除的余数。
-
事件指令:
- 当开始时(on start):在程序开始时执行一组指令。
- 当按钮按下(on button pressed):当特定按钮被按下时执行一组指令。
- 当收到消息(on message received):当收到特定消息时执行一组指令。
-
传感器和动作指令:
- 获取加速度(get acceleration):获取加速度传感器的值。
- 点亮LED灯(light up LED):点亮指定的LED灯。
- 播放音乐(play music):播放指定的音乐。
这只是编程猫引擎中的一小部分指令,实际上还有很多其他指令可以用于创建更丰富的程序。编程猫引擎还提供了许多拓展和自定义指令的功能,以满足不同编程需求。初学者可以通过拖拽和连接积木块来组合这些指令,从而轻松编写自己的程序。
1年前 -